This is a beautiful ride taking us Northeast of Seattle.  The ride is posted as moderate, which is a pace of 14-16 on the flats with no head wind.  However, as this is the longest ride many of us will have done this season, I will be leading it at the lower end of the moderate range to make sure we can all finish.  

Hills:  There are three significant hills on the route (and a few rollers that don't count) and we will regroup at both the top and the bottom of each hill.  

Rest Stops:  There will be a water stop in Maltby (mi 18) or Snohomish (mi 26), a lunch stop in Sultan at mile 42, and a secret ice cream stop in Maltby (think Affogatos!!) at mile 65 (that is not shown on the cue sheet). Even so, for long rides, it is best to eat a little something along the way, so come prepared with your own food.

Since the ride is over 80 miles, please make sure to bring a printed cue sheet or download the route into your Garmin or phone. You should come prepared to repair any flats or mechanicals on your own; but we will stand by and watch (some may even help).
